Bjørn Forsman bd01fad0ed Captialize meta.description of all packages
In line with the Nixpkgs manual.

A mechanical change, done with this command:

  find pkgs -name "*.nix" | \
      while read f; do \
          sed -e 's/description\s*=\s*"\([a-z]\)/description = "\u\1/' -i "$f"; \
      done

I manually skipped some:

* Descriptions starting with an abbreviation, a user name or package name
* Frequently generated expressions (haskell-packages.nix)

{ stdenv, fetchurl, pkgconfig, libxml2, perl }:
let
name = "libsmbios-2.2.28";
in
stdenv.mkDerivation {
inherit name;
src = fetchurl {
url = "http://linux.dell.com/libsmbios/download/libsmbios/${name}/${name}.tar.gz";
sha256 = "03m0n834w49acwbf5cf9ync1ksnn2jkwaysvy7584y60qpmngb91";
};
buildInputs = [ pkgconfig libxml2 perl ];
# It tries to install some Python stuff even when Python is disabled.
installFlags = "pkgpythondir=$(TMPDIR)/python";
# It forgets to install headers.
postInstall =
''
cp -va "src/include/"* "$out/include/"
cp -va "out/public-include/"* "$out/include/"
'';
meta = {
homepage = "http://linux.dell.com/libsmbios/main";
description = "A library to obtain BIOS information";
license = stdenv.lib.licenses.gpl2Plus; # alternatively, under the Open Software License version 2.1
platforms = stdenv.lib.platforms.linux;
};
}
